Cranbury Policemen’s Benevolent Association Local 405 is now accepting applications for its annual scholarships! A Cranbury resident, who is a senior at Princeton High School and has been accepted/enrolled as a full-time student at a college or university, is eligible to apply. For more information regarding eligibility and the application process, please email nrodriguespba405@gmail.com or visit www.cranburypba405.com.
